My NOOK is sluggish or unresponsive.
Like any computer or electronic equipment, your NOOK periodically needs to be completely powered off (not just put in Sleep Mode) to allow it to reset.
To power off your NOOK, press and hold the power button for 10 seconds. At that point, the device should be turned-off. Wait a few seconds, and then press and hold the power button for about 2 seconds to turn your NOOK back on.
The screen is acting as though I’m tapping it, even though I am not.
If your screen is dirty, it might detect touches when none are occurring. This problem can occur on any touchscreen device. Turn off your NOOK, and wipe the screen clean with a soft, dry cloth. Pay particular attention to clear out or gently blow out any dust or dirt from the small lip around the edges of the display. Then turn your NOOK back on.
I’m trying to lend a book through Facebook, but the Post button doesn’t seem to be working.
Make sure you include a comment with your posting about lending the book. Posting a LendMe offer through Facebook requires at least a brief comment.
I transferred a ZIP archive from my personal computer. Why can’t I access the files?
Unzip files on your personal computer before transferring them to your NOOK. Your NOOK can read EPUB files and PDFs, but not .zip files.
